Music Game Fans Loyal to the Genre, Not a Franchise


It really won't.According to Gamasutra, a report from market-research firm DFC Intelligence on the habits of music-game players shows some interesting results: Namely, that fans of music games tend not to be particularly loyal to either the Guitar Hero or Rock Band franchises.

From the article:

In general, broad loyalty to the music game genre seemed to win out over loyalty to specific brands. Nearly a quarter of Guitar Hero World Tour users went on to play Guitar Hero 5 less than a month after the new game was released, but almost as many — 21 percent — also played The Beatles: Rock Band.

I find that interesting given how often I hear fans of one franchise bash the other in message board posts and comment threads. On the other hand, my own experience is pretty much in line with this study: I’ll play whatever has the songs I want to play.
